The present study was undertaken to know the extent of polyembryony in three mango rootstocks, namely Olour, Kurukkan and 13-1. Freshly harvested seeds after 10 days were sown in earthen pots (sand: soil:FYM; 1:1:1). The number of seedlings from stones of Olour, Kurukkan and 13-1 were recorded and extent of
polyembryony was calculated. The extent of polyembryony was maximum in Kurukkan (74.43%) followed by 13-1 (51.85%) and Olour (33.15%). The number of seedlings per stone ranged from 1 to 5 in Olour & Kurukkan; and 1 to 4 in 13-1 rootstock. The average number of seedlings per stone was maximum in Kurukkan (2.35) followed by 13-1 (1.88) and Olour (1.51).
